M. Alan Webb

Veteran U.S. Marines, Korean Conflict;

M. Alan Webb, age 85, of Lowell died peacefully on Sunday August 30, 2020 at D’Youville Senior Care in Lowell.

Alan was born in Morriston, NJ on April 16, 1934, to Ruby and Milton Webb.

He worked for GTE for many years and was able to travel the world to the Philippines, Costa Rica, and Israel where he met his wife.  Sarit came to USA and they were married for over 29 years. Sarit passed away in 2016 due to cancer and left behind a daughter Marina Milucci of Florida.

A resident of Lowell Mass. Alan is survived by his two adult children Debra (Webb) Gilbert and Mark Webb and his wife Lijun Xia from China. He has 2 adult grandchildren Ashley Rose Gilbert of Billerica and Jimmy D. Gilbert Jr.  of Lowell and 2 great grandchildren McKenzie Holak and Carter Gilbert.

He was 1 of 3 siblings. Jean Hill, his sister passed in 2002 and his brother Donald is whereabouts unknown. He is also survived by his niece Nancy Lawson and her husband Ken and his nephew Ken and many great nephews and nieces.     

      Alan loved to golf and was a member of the Nabnasset Lake Country Club in the 70’s and some part of the 80’s before moving to Hudson, Florida. There he did some part-time shuttle work and airport runs. He worked out at the gym and walked 1 mile every day. He enjoyed fishing and going to Las Vegas with his wife.
